14, SHIRLEY CLOSE, GRAVESEND, DA12 4XR - £330,000

14 SHIRLEY CLOSE is a very small detached house of 62m², built sometime between 1991 and 1995. It was last sold for £330,000 in April 2022, which was around 49% below the average April 2022 detached price in the Gravesham local authority area. The most recent EPC inspection was October 2023, where the current energy rating was C, and the potential energy rating was B.

14 SHIRLEY CLOSE Price Paid vs. HPI Average

The below graph shows the average detached house price in the Gravesham local authority area over time, sourced from the HPI. The two 14 SHIRLEY CLOSE sales from April 2002 and April 2022 have been plotted on the graph. A line has been extrapolated to show what the value of the property might have been over time, following each sale, had it maintained the same margin above or below the HPI (as a percentage). For example, the April 2002 sale was for 48% below the HPI. So the extrapolation line tracks at 48% below the HPI over time, until the April 2022 sale, where it falls to 49% below the HPI. The line then continues to track at 49% below the HPI.

14 SHIRLEY CLOSE: Plot and Title Map

14 SHIRLEY CLOSE sits on a plot of roughly 0.039 of an acre, or 159m². The below map shows the location of 14 SHIRLEY CLOSE, an approximate outline of the building(s), and the indicative extent of the property. The plot extent is a Land Registry INSPIRE Index Polygon, and it is important to note that a title may include more than one polygon, whereas only one polygon is shown on the map (the polygon which intersects with the position of 14 SHIRLEY CLOSE). The full extent of the land contained in any registered title can only be identified from the individual title plan. The maps on this page should not be relied upon to establish the extent of a title.
